Nothing ever stays calm in Possum Creek for long.

After watching her husband make-out with another woman during her best friend's wedding, Katie has been forced to acknowledge that her own happily ever after is more like a B-rated horror movie than a fairy tale. 

Katie loves her daughter more than life itself, but she's pretty sure that Ian loves his Xbox more than he loves either one of them. Addison, the man Katie's been secretly in love with from the safety of the friend-zone for most of her adult life, thinks she's pathetic. At least, that's what his girlfriend told her.

Katie doesn't know what her future holds, but she knows it's past time for a change. She's done wasting her life trying to please Ian while silently lusting after Addy. She's ready to move on and leave her feelings for both of them in the past.

Addison Malone thinks the dust has finally settled after his sister's wedding. He couldn't be more wrong. The evidence in a rash of burglaries that have struck Possum Creek and the surrounding area make it apparent that he and his friends are being betrayed by someone they've always considered one of their own. When Katie makes it clear that she's ready to walk away from him forever, Addison is left scrambling to fix their relationship while he's still trying to get to the bottom of the crime spree.
